Unrestricted | Published by Siemens Healthcare GmbH © Siemens Healthcare GmbH, 2022 Page 22 of 29 2.3.2 Pulmonary CTA scan workflow Exercises 1. Patient registration: Select a patient from the Scheduler. 2. Delete the texts in the Requested Procedure\Description. HeadRoutine Requested Procedure Description HeadRoutine Accession No ID f15333aa-69b3-42 Comments 3. Press Exam. 4. Protocol selection: Select the Pulmonary CTA [factory] protocol from the pulmonary area on the schematic vascular body map. Adult Child Trauma Specials Intervention 5. Press OK to load the protocol. 6. Confirm the topo settings by pressing the green button. Unrestricted | Published by Siemens Healthcare GmbH © Siemens Healthcare GmbH, 2022 Page 23 of 29 7. Press GO to load and perform the topogram. 8. Press the Start button in the pop up Control Box UI. The topogram image will be displayed in the left image segment. 9. Premonitoring step: Move the displayed range to the correct monitoring position by clicking the double dotted line. Move the range by dragging and dropping with the white dot in the middle. 10. Select Go to activate and load the premonitoring scan, follow the instructions below the Execution Control buttons to perform the scan (hold down the Move button and then press Start ). 11. After the premonitoring image is displayed in the tomo Unrestricted | Published by Siemens Healthcare GmbH © Siemens Healthcare GmbH, 2022 Page 24 of 29 segment, an ROI is automatically placed in the pulmonary artery (FAST ROI function). 12. Monitoring step: Check the trigger level, press the left mouse button on the magenta line and drag it up and down, to a place lower than 100. HU 94 50 Trigger Level [HU]: 94 0 5 10 (Because the simulation image data does not support a level higher than 100, if the level is set above 100, the following spiral CTA scan cannot be triggered. During a real scan, the trigger level should be defined by an expert tech or predefined in the protocol). 13. Before loading the monitoring scan, click the spiral CTA scan on the timeline to check the scan range on the topogram. Usually, the scan range is defined automatically by the system using the FAST Planning function. You can also adjust the scan range on the topogram manually. To show the recon range frame, click once on the edge of the transparent area. 5/3/2022 11:28:50.31 AM 1 IMA 1 TP1 -1,047.3 TOP 100 TP2 -759.0 TP -750.0 LEN 288.3 R --- 1.0cm Now you can adjust the range by moving the white dots on the violet frame with the left mouse button. As soon as the injector is enabled, the CT Control Box pops up. Press the Start button to start the monitoring scan. The system will measure the CT value in the ROI for each monitoring scan, and trigger the CTA spiral as soon as the value Unrestricted | Published by Siemens Healthcare GmbH © Siemens Healthcare GmbH, 2022 Page 28 of 29 reaches the predefined magenta line. 19.
